A Brief analysis of the Baldwin Incinerator
The Baldwin Incinerator is a waste-to-energy facility that burns municipal solid waste to produce electricity. The facility has been in operation for several decades and is owned and operated by a private company. It is designed to handle a significant amount of waste, with a capacity to burn over 1,000 tons of trash per day. While the incinerator is equipped with pollution control devices, concerns about its impact on air quality and public health persist.
Health Concerns Associated with the Baldwin Incinerator
The burning of waste at the Baldwin Incinerator releases a cocktail of toxic pollutants into the air, including particulate matter, carbon monoxide, and volatile organic compounds (VOCs). These pollutants have been linked to a range of health problems, including respiratory diseases, cardiovascular disease, and even cancer. The incinerator’s proximity to residential areas and schools has raised concerns about the potential health impacts on vulnerable populations, such as children and the elderly.

Toxic Emissions
The Baldwin Incinerator emits a range of toxic pollutants, including dioxins, furans, and heavy metals. These pollutants have been linked to a range of health problems, including cancer, reproductive issues, and neurological damage. The incinerator’s emissions have been shown to exceed federal and state standards, raising concerns about the potential health impacts on nearby communities.
Environmental Impact
The Baldwin Incinerator also has a significant environmental impact, with concerns about greenhouse gas emissions, ash disposal, and water pollution. The incinerator’s emissions contribute to climate change, while the ash generated by the facility is often disposed of in landfills, where it can contaminate soil and groundwater. The facility’s water pollution has also raised concerns, with nearby waterways showing signs of contamination.
